Bids Wanted,
Bids will be received by the
school hoard of d istric t No 14, Bor­
ing, for fu rnishing 20 cords of No. 1
first-grow th 16-inch wood to be
stacked tn woodshed of said d is­
tric t. Bids received until 8:15
p. nt., Ju ly 21, 1928. T he board re ­
serves the right to reject any or
all bids.
